Budget and Affordability

What comes first before deciding to rent a house is to know the budget? It is deciding on the amount that one can comfortably be able to pay for rent on a monthly basis considering every monthly expenditures, check out the new homes for rent in Rosharon, TX to fulfill all your needs. Also, keep in mind that prices for rental payments can differ greatly depending on such differentiating factors that includes:

  • Location
  • Size
  • Amenities
  • Market demand

It is also important to be realistic as per what you can and can’t afford so that you don’t get yourself into dept problems. Also, many forget to budget for the one-time fees such as security deposits and application fees in your budget for the rental. 

Location and Neighbourhood

Location is the key element in a rental property and thus, the perfect neighborhood where your lifestyle and preferences are in place is the best. Look at factors like distance to your job or school, how well it is connected by public transport, how safe it is, how convenient it is in terms of amenities (grocery stores, parks, restaurants), and how the area in general feels.

 Research crime rates, school districts, local attractions that are in line with your likes and what suits your needs for quality of life. Visit a neighborhood in the morning, then during the day, and lastly at night to get a feel for whether it seems right for you during these different periods of time.

Size and Layout

Evaluate the space you need according to the amount of usage that will be made of it, the style of life you are living, and the needs you have. Consider storage space, efficiency in layout, and how to configure your rooms. Keep in mind that more space could mean the luxury of more room to spread out, but it also means a more expensive rental and a spike in utility costs. Highlight features that would make your life, your daily routine, and generally your activities easier, and also consider features that are not the highest priority.
